Abstract :
An efficient diagnostic method is proposed for complex device fault diagnosis. In rule-based reasoning, an efficient retrieving strategy is crucial. The generic retrieving method is based on a diagnostic tree built according to the hierarchical decomposition of devices, but it is difficult to achieve such diagnostic tree for some complex devices. So a multiple hierarchical diagnosis method based on fault categories is proposed. And then, the retrieving priorities of rules in a certain diagnostic level are determined based on a fuzzy multi-attribute group decision-making method, which can more effectively work out the priority factors. Based on this diagnostic method, a fault diagnosis system for intelligent instruments was developed based on SQL2005 database. And comparison between two systems is presented to validate the diagnostic method.
